#d4bb95 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d4bb95 is composed of 83.1% red, 73.3%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.8% magenta, 29.7%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 36.2 degrees, a saturation of 42.3% and a lightness of 70.8%. #d4bb95 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a9772b.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

● #d4bb95 color description : Slightly desaturated orange.
#d4bb95 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d4bb95 has RGB values of R:212, G:187,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.12, Y:0.3,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13941653.

Shades and Tints of #d4bb95
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060402 is the darkest color, while #fcfaf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d4bb95
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b7b5b2 is the less saturated color, while #fcc36d is the most saturated one.
